Doha: The Qatar Stars League began with an exciting draw between Al Wakrah and Qatar SC, alongside a narrow victory for Al Rayyan against Lusail. Al Wakrah and Qatar SC ended their opening match in a 2-2 draw, setting a dynamic tone for the season.
According to National Iraqi News Agency, the match saw Icelandic player Aron score the opening goal for Qatar SC in the 18th minute. Al Wakrah responded with an equalizer from Algerian Redouane Berkane during first-half stoppage time. The second half continued the thrilling contest as Moroccan Amine Zahzouh put Al Wakrah ahead in the 67th minute. However, Qatar SC’s Brazilian player Bruno Tabata managed to level the score, ensuring a dramatic conclusion to the match.
In another fixture, Al Rayyan started their campaign with a significant 1-0 win against Lusail, who have recently been promoted. The victory was secured by a late first-half goal from Brazilian Gabriel Pereira, which was enough to earn Al Rayyan the three points.
